Supreme Court hearing on urgent matter on pil is filed in Jharkhand HC Against CM & other individuals

By LawStreet News Network      19 May, 2022 12:51 PM      0 Comments
Supreme Court hearing on urgent matter on pil is filed in Jharkhand HC Against CM & other individuals

Sr Adv Kapil Sibal mentions: This is a serious matter i seek to mention. A pil is filed in Jharkhand HC (against CM & other individuals) which is not yet admitted, ED comes and hands over sealed cover

Sr Adv Kapil Sibal mentions: I object to it, in these proceedings FIR isnt registered. HC has looked at sealed cover & theyve now said theyll transfer it to CBI. Ive told them now Ill mention it here.

Bench- somebody else filed PIL?

Sibal: Yes against CM, individuals etc. CBI ED made parties. We said how can you take these documents on record!

Sr Adv Mukul Rohatgi: Court is on leave, theres nothing urgent in this case. Everyday is being listed at 2 pm.

Rohatgi: Sealed cover documents are being filed, not shown to us. Pls list tomorrow

Bench- okay tomorrow

Sr Adv Kapil Sibal before CJI Led bench: PIL filed in Jharkhand HC against CM, CBI, ED and not admitted yet. Enforcement Directorate comes and hands over a sealed cover. HC looked at it, opened it and called for 16 FIRs and now transfers to CBI. No ECIR, Nothing

Sr Adv Kapil Sibal: I told the HC not to proceed since I am mentioning it here. Now vacation bench is hearing it regualarly what is this?

Sr Adv Rohatgi: Please stay the proceedings

CJI: List this tomorrow
